How do I set High Definition Audio Device to be the default?
- Press Windows Key + x and select Control Panel.
- Select Hardware and sound and next click on playback tab.
- In playback tab, right click on High Definition Audio Device and select Set as default device.
How do I enable audio device in Windows?
In Device Manager
- On your keyboard, press Windows logo key and X at the same time, and then choose Device Manager.
- Locate and expand category Sound, video and game controllers to find your audio device driver.
- Right-click your audio device driver and choose Enable device.

Why are my speakers not working Windows 10?
Uninstall and reinstall your audio driver. If updating your Windows 10 audio driver doesn’t work, try uninstalling and reinstalling it. Find your sound card in the Device Manager again, then right-click it and select Uninstall. Windows re-installs the driver at the next system reboot.

How do I enable Speakers in Windows 10?
In the “Settings” window, select “System.” Click “Sound” on the window’s sidebar. Locate the “Output” section on the “Sound” screen. In the drop-down menu labeled “Choose your output device,” click the speakers you’d like to use as your default.
